‘Liv Up’ seminar tomorrow

June 24, 2017 12:57 am | Updated 12:57 am IST - VISAKHAPATNAM

A seminar on liver diseases ‘Liv Up’ will be organised by the Department of Gastroenterology, Andhra Medical College, in collaboration with the Gut Club, Vizag, at Hotel Gateway on June 25.

Addressing a media conference in this connection on Friday, Emeritus Professor of Gastroenterology E. Pedaveerraju and HoD of Gastroenterology Girinadh said the last five years had seen new management protocols in Hepatitis C. The non-alcoholic fatty liver disease has now emerged as the challenge for the decade. Hepatitis B still has no definite cure.

Endoscopic tools like cholangioscopy and endoscopic ultrasound and advanced radiology techniques have greatly improved the diagnostic capabilities. The update on liver diseases was intended to share the knowledge on a common platform among physicians and family practitioners. Vice-Chancellor of Dr. NTR University of Health Sciences, Vijayawada, T. Ravi Raju, KGH Superintendent G. Arjuna, AMC Principal P.V. Sudhakar, president SGEI, Apollo Hospital, Kolkata, Mahesh Kumar Goenka, senior consultant gastroenterologist A.V. Siva Prasad will participate in the inaugural function.

Liv Up- 2017 is dedicated to the memory of the legendary gastroenterologist P. Muralikrishna.
